Job Description

Under general supervision, provides nursing care in a specialty area. Core responsibilities include:

  • Managing an assigned group of patients
  • Documenting patient responses and changes in physician orders
  • Assisting physicians with examinations and minor diagnostic procedures
  • Monitoring physiological data and intervening as necessary
  • Administering medications and managing IV infusions and blood products
  • Delivering competent patient care and communicating care plans to patients and families
  • Overseeing treatment by technicians or other service providers
  • Referring patient care needs to appropriate personnel
  • Delegating tasks to support staff
  • Performing other assigned duties

Required Skills & Experience

  • Minimum 1 year of nursing experience
  • Ability to function independently in the specialty area after orientation
  • Knowledge of professional nursing theory, practices, techniques, and procedures
  • Strong organizational, planning, coordination, and evaluation skills
  • Ability to maintain good working relationships and communicate effectively
  • Ability to work effectively as part of a team providing specialized care
  • Basic computer skills

Education Requirements

  • Associate's Degree in Nursing from an accredited program (required)
  • Bachelor of Science in Nursing or higher (preferred)

Certifications & Licensure

  • Current RN License issued by the Oklahoma State Board of Nursing or a current multistate compact RN License (eNLC)
  • Current Basic Life Support (BLS) certification from the American Heart Association
  • ACLS (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support) certification from the American Heart Association
  • PALS (Pediatric Advanced Life Support) certification from the American Heart Association

About Oklahoma City, OK

As a Travel Electrophysiology Lab Nurse in Oklahoma City, OK here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• The cost of living in Oklahoma City is lower than the national average, making it an affordable place to live.
  • Wages generally match up with the lower cost of living.
Weather
  • Summer average high: 93°F, average low: 71°F.
  • Winter average high: 49°F, average low: 28°F.
Furnished Housing
  • Short term rentals are available and relatively easy to find in Oklahoma City.
Transportation
  • Oklahoma City is car-friendly, and public transportation options include buses and a streetcar system.
Demographics
  • The city has a diverse population with a wide age range.
  • Common health issues include obesity and related conditions.
  • Oklahoma City has a growing population of travel nurses.
Things to Do
  • Oklahoma City offers a variety of restaurants, art galleries, music venues, and sports events.
  •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y parks, lakes, and hiking trails.
